Usay Compare is seeking a Renewals Sales Advisor to manage and support existing clients, reviewing medical insurance needs year-on-year and building long-term relationships with tailored advice.

Hybrid/remote options are available after training, with offices across the UK including South Cerney.

The role requires experience in a regulated sales environment, strong communication skills, and a consultative approach to guidance and service.
